Benefits of Automotive Window Tinting
UV Protection
Harmful UV rays can cause fading and cracking on dashboards, seats, and other interior surfaces. Tinted windows block up to 99% of UV radiation, helping preserve a vehicle’s condition.
Heat Reduction
Tinted windows help regulate interior temperatures by reducing heat buildup, creating a more comfortable driving experience.
Glare Reduction
Bright sunlight and headlights from other vehicles can cause visibility issues. Tinted windows cut down glare, improving safety and reducing eye strain.
Privacy and Security
Darkened windows make it harder for outsiders to see inside a vehicle, helping protect valuables and providing a greater sense of privacy.
Shatter Resistance
Window film adds an extra layer of protection, keeping glass from shattering easily in the event of an accident or break-in.
Types of Window Tinting Films
Dyed Window Film
A budget-friendly option that provides good privacy and glare reduction. It absorbs heat but doesn’t offer as much infrared protection as other films.
Metalized Window Film
Contains metallic particles that reflect heat and UV rays while adding extra strength to the glass. It offers strong durability but may interfere with electronic signals.
Carbon Window Film
Provides excellent heat rejection without affecting signal reception. It has a sleek, matte finish that enhances the vehicle’s look.
Ceramic Window Film
One of the highest-quality options, ceramic film offers superior UV and heat rejection while maintaining excellent visibility. It doesn’t fade over time and provides strong shatter resistance.
Maryland Window Tinting Laws
Maryland has specific regulations for window tinting, including:
-
Front Side Windows: Must allow at least 35% of light through.
-
Rear Side Windows: No restrictions for passenger vehicles.
-
Rear Window: No restrictions for passenger vehicles.
-
Windshield: Only a non-reflective tint along the top 5 inches.
